diff options
Diffstat (limited to 'TAO/CIAO/DAnCE/ciao/Servant_Impl_Base.h')
-rw-r--r-- | TAO/CIAO/DAnCE/ciao/Servant_Impl_Base.h | 17 |
1 files changed, 15 insertions, 2 deletions
diff --git a/TAO/CIAO/DAnCE/ciao/Servant_Impl_Base.h b/TAO/CIAO/DAnCE/ciao/Servant_Impl_Base.h index cf159fe5ec8..56e5df456aa 100644 --- a/TAO/CIAO/DAnCE/ciao/Servant_Impl_Base.h +++ b/TAO/CIAO/DAnCE/ciao/Servant_Impl_Base.h @@ -52,7 +52,7 @@ namespace CIAO virtual ~Servant_Impl_Base (void); /// Operations for CCMObject interface. -/* + virtual void component_UUID ( const char * new_component_UUID @@ -63,6 +63,18 @@ namespace CIAO component_UUID ( 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S) ACE_THROW_SPEC ((CORBA::SystemException)); + +/* + virtual void + set_comp_UUID ( + const char * new_component_UUID + ACE_ENV_ARG_DECL_WITH_DEFAULTS) + ACE_THROW_SPEC ((CORBA::SystemException)); + + virtual CIAO::CONNECTION_ID + get_comp_UUID ( + 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S) + ACE_THROW_SPEC ((CORBA::SystemException)); */ virtual ::Components::PrimaryKeyBase * get_primary_key (ACE_ENV_SINGLE_ARG_DECL_WITH_DEFAULTS) @@ -218,7 +230,8 @@ namespace CIAO ConsumerTable consumer_table_; Session_Container * container_; - // ACE_CString component_UUID_; + //ACE_CString comp_UUID_; + ACE_CString component_UUID_; }; } |